Ingredients
-
1/2 cup almonds
-
1/2 cup peanuts
-
1/4 cup pumpkin seeds
-
1/2 cup oats
-
1/4 cup sunflower seeds
-
1 tablespoon fennel seeds
-
2 tablespoons flaxseeds
-
2 tablespoons chia seeds
-
1 tablespoon poppy seeds
-
2 tablespoons dried Indian gooseberry (amla) powder
-
1 tablespoon beetroot powder
-
1 tablespoon dried rose petals (powdered)
-
1 tablespoon moringa powder
Instructions
Roasting
-
Heat a heavy-bottomed pan on low flame.
-
Dry roast the almonds, peanuts, pumpkin seeds, oats, sunflower seeds, fennel seeds, flaxseeds, chia seeds, and poppy seeds.
-
Stir continuously for 5–7 minutes until the ingredients release a mild nutty aroma. Avoid burning.
-
Remove from heat and allow the mixture to cool completely to preserve nutrients.
Making the Collagen Powder
-
Transfer the cooled roasted ingredients to a dry blender or food processor.
-
Grind into a fine, uniform powder.
-
Add amla powder, beetroot powder, rose petal powder, and moringa powder.
-
Pulse again until all ingredients are evenly combined.
Storage
-
Store the prepared powder in a clean, airtight glass jar.
-
Keep in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
-
Shelf life: approximately 2–3 months when stored properly.
How to Use
-
Morning Detox Drink: Mix 1 tablespoon of the powder with 1 teaspoon of organic honey in warm water. Drink on an empty stomach for best absorption.
-
Daily Nutrition Boost: Add 1–2 tablespoons to warm milk, smoothies, yogurt, or plant-based milk.
-
Meal Enhancer: Sprinkle over oatmeal, porridge, cereals, or healthy desserts.
-
Energy Tonic: Mix with honey or ghee for a natural energy and immunity booster.
For best results, use consistently as part of a balanced diet and healthy lifestyle.
